The Motorola Moto E14 features a 6.560 Zoll display and a camera with 13 MP resolution. In comparison, the Oppo Reno12 F 4G (2024) comes with a 6.670 Zoll display and 50.10 MP megapixels.
In terms of battery, the 5000 mAh (Motorola Moto E14) or 5000 mAh (Oppo Reno12 F 4G (2024)) provides enough power for everyday use. Storage and performance also make a difference: 64 GB GB vs 256 GB GB storage, 2 GB vs 8 GB RAM.

The Motorola Moto E14 boasts a modern yet simplistic design with dimensions perfect for one-handed use. Measuring 163.49 mm in height, 74.53 mm in width, and a sleek thickness of 7.99 mm, this device fits comfortably in hand while delivering sturdy construction, weighing a mere 178 grams. The overall design reflects the classic Moto aesthetic, ensuring a device that looks as good as it feels.
Featuring a 6.56-inch LED display, the Moto E14 offers a vivid viewing experience with a resolution of 720x1612 pixels. With a pixel density of 269 PPI and a refresh rate of 90 Hz, users can enjoy smooth scrolling and crisp visuals. The display supports 16 million colors, enhancing the viewing experience, whether you're watching videos or browsing the web.
The camera setup on the Moto E14 is designed to capture life's moments with ease. The 13 MP main camera comes equipped with features such as HDR photo, face detection, and macro mode, allowing for versatile photography. The front-facing camera, at 4.9 MP, includes face retouch and panorama photo options, making it ideal for selfies and video calls. Both cameras are capable of recording 1080p videos at 30 fps, offering good quality video capture.
Powered by the UNISOC Tiger T606 UMS9230 processor and ARM Mali-G57 GPU, the Moto E14 promises a seamless user experience for everyday tasks. With 2 GB of RAM and 64 GB of onboard storage, expandable via microSD, users have plenty of room for apps, photos, and more. Connectivity options include Bluetooth 5.0, dual SIM support, and Wi-Fi, making it easy to stay connected on the go.
One of the standout features of the Moto E14 is its impressive 5000 mAh battery, ensuring reliable performance throughout the day. The lithium-ion polymer battery supports 15 W charging, providing a quick top-up when needed and eliminating worries about running out of power during the day.
The Moto E14 is equipped with various smart features, including voice commands and an intelligent personal assistant to facilitate multitasking. It also includes navigation software for hassle-free travel and face recognition for enhanced security. The inclusion of sensors like a light intensity sensor, proximity sensor, and accelerometer rounds out this well-balanced package.

The Oppo Reno12 F 4G doesn't disappoint when it comes to design. Sporting dimensions of 163.1 mm in height, 75.8 mm in width, and a slim thickness of just 7.76 mm, it has a comfortable hold and premium feel. Weighing 187 grams, it sits in the balance of heftiness and portability.
The 6.67-inch self-illuminating display is a visual delight. With a resolution of 1080x2400 pixels and a pixel density of 395 PPI, it delivers sharpness and clarity akin to no other. To top it off, the display supports dynamic refresh rates of 120 Hz and can even hit up to 180 Hz, making it perfect for gaming and smooth scrolling, while offering vibrant colors across its palette of 16 million hues.
Equipped with a Qualcomm Snapdragon 680 SM6225 processor and a Qualcomm Adreno 610 GPU, the Oppo Reno12 F 4G promises swift performance. With 8 GB of RAM, the device excels in multitasking, while its expansive storage of 256 GB ensures ample space for apps, photos, and videos.
A 5000 mAh lithium-ion polymer battery provides considerable endurance, keeping your device running throughout the day. With its 45 W charging power, you'll spend less time tethered to an outlet, thanks to rapid charging capabilities.
Photography enthusiasts will revel in the main camera's 50.1 MP resolution, coupled with features like pixel unification, HDR photo and video, and a spectrum of modes including slow motion and panorama. Thanks to its optical zoom capabilities and 10x digital zoom, your shots will be immersive and crisp.
The front camera isn't far behind, boasting a significant 32 MP. It supports HDR photos and an array of modes designed to capture the perfect shot, whether it's a spontaneous smile or a majestic panorama.

Supporting dual SIM functionality and 4G network capabilities, the Oppo Reno12 F 4G keeps you in touch wherever you are. It encompasses WiFi capabilities up to IEEE 802.11ac and Bluetooth version 5.0, promoting efficient connectivity. The audio output via USB Type-C ensures a modern, high-quality audio experience.
